Job Description

We are seeking a dedicated and enthusiastic Teaching Assistant to support teaching and learning in Key Stage 2. The successful candidate will work closely with class teachers to provide high-quality support to pupils, helping them to achieve their full potential academically, socially, and emotionally.

Key Responsibilities

  • Support the class teacher in delivering engaging and effective lessons across the KS2 curriculum.
  • Work with individual pupils or small groups to reinforce learning objectives and provide targeted interventions.
  • Assist in the preparation of learning materials and classroom resources.
  • Promote positive behaviour and help maintain a safe, inclusive, and stimulating learning environment.
  • Support pupils with additional needs, including those with SEND, EAL, or behavioural challenges.
  • Monitor and record pupil progress, providing feedback to the teacher.
  • Supervise pupils during break times, lunchtimes, and on school trips as required.
  • Collaborate with teachers, SENCOs, and other staff to ensure consistent support for all learners.
  • Uphold the school's safeguarding policies and procedures at all times.
  • Person Specification

    Essential:

  • Experience working with children in a school or educational setting.
  • Good literacy and numeracy skills (GCSE English and Maths or equivalent).
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ills.
  • A patient, caring, and flexible approach to supporting children's learning.
  • Commitment to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children.
  • Desirable:

  • Level 2 or 3 Teaching Assistant qualification (e.g., CACHE, NCFE).
  • Experience supporting pupils in Key Stage 2.
  • Knowledge of the National Curriculum and assessment strategies.
  • Experience working with children with SEND or behavioural needs.
  • First Aid and/or Safeguarding training.
